Tamil Language Entrance Proficiency Test
The Tamil Language Entrance Proficiency Test (TL EPT) is applicable to candidates applying to teach Tamil Language.
The test comprises 2 parts:
- Part 1 involves a test of oral proficiency: it requires candidates to read a passage aloud and deliver a short speech without notes on a given topic. Candidates will be given a few minutes to preview the reading passage and to prepare for the talk.
- Part 2 is a test of knowledge in grammar, vocabulary usage and stylistic features of the language. Candidates will also be tested on reading comprehension.
Exemption Criteria
Candidates who fulfil any of the criteria below are exempted from the TL EPT.
- Pass degree graduates in Tamil Language / Literature from UniSIM OR any universities from Tamil Nadu, India OR
- Applicants who scored an ‘A’ Level pass with at least a Grade C in Higher Tamil (formerly known as TL1) OR at least a Grade B in Tamil (formerly known as TL2) at the GCE ‘A’ Level examination OR
- Applicants who scored at least a Grade B in H2 Tamil Language and Literature at the GCE ‘A’ Level Examination OR
- Applicants who scored at least a Grade B in H1 Tamil Language at the GCE ‘A’ Level Examination OR
- Applicants who scored at least a Grade A2 in Higher Tamil (formerly known as TL1) at the GCE ‘O’ Level Examination OR
- Applicants who scored at least a Grade 5 in Tamil at the International Baccalaureate Examination.

The cost of sitting for the written and oral tests is S$110.00 nett. Each component test (written or oral) costs S$55.00 nett. The registration fee is non-refundable. No refund of payment will be given to candidates who register but did not sit for or withdraw from the test.
After your payment has been made, you will receive an official receipt. Applicants will be scheduled to sit for the EPT on the next earliest available test date. Notification of test dates, time and venue will be sent to applicants 1 to 2 weeks prior to the test.
Statement of Result
Candidates will receive a Statement of Result indicating a ‘Pass’ or ‘Fail’.
The result is valid for a period of 4 years.
Please note that requests for review of results will not be entertained.
